Subject description
We are working on developing robotic skills with the aim of fast and simplified programming. For this, we integrate computer vision, actuation (mobile platform, arm, gripper) with a suitable knowledge integration framework, reasoning, learning and classic AI.

Work duties
The main duties involved in a researcher position is to conduct research. The focus will be on programming and evaluating a complete autonomous robot system. Starting point will be the existing open source system SkiROS that runs at TRL5. The task  will be to push the SkiROS framework to TRL7. 

Other work duties are: 

  • collaborate with our PhD and master students in their work with SkiROS.
  • develop, evaluate and publish own work within SkiROS.
  • contribute to further research directions of SkiROS.
